Hi,
I hope someone will be able to help me diagnose my problem. I was flushing my coolant today in my 94 del sol si. It has a 95 B18C1 motor. When I got finished with filling it up and took it for a test run, whenever I hit around 3200 RPM the launch control would kick in and not let me rev any higher. The speedo is out and so is the odometer. All the other gauges work fine.
I'm thinking the launch control problem has something to do with the speedo always being at 0. I'm not sure how it works but it seems possible the computer thinks we are not moving.
When I was flushing the coolant I unhooked one wire from near the Vtec Solenoid. It was not the wire hooked directly to the solenoid. Just below/behind it. It is green connector on my car. When I tried to plug it back in it did not snap in like the other connectors. Does anyone know what this wire is or If this has anything to do with it?
This is the connector I was talking about. It anyone has any idea please let me know. I'll appreciate any help.
